520 _aPathogenicity island (PAIs) are a group of mobile genetic elements that play a pivotal role in the virulence of bacterial pathogens of humans.Typical PAIs are distinct regions of DNA that are present in the genome of pathogenic bacteria.PAIs are mostly inserted in the backbone genome of the host strain at specific sites
